Job Summary

Responsible for assembling, testing, and packaging sub-assemblies and finished products in a controlled clean room environment while following established work instructions, manufacturing documentation, and quality stand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assemble sub-components and finished products independently and as part of a team using manual fabrication techniques.

  • Build detailed, precision-based assemblies by following approved work instructions and manufacturing documentation.

  • Perform mechanical and electrical testing on completed assemblies to ensure compliance with quality and performance specifications.

  • Support manufacturing operations by working across one or more designated production cells.

  • Maintain a clean, organized, and compliant work area, including routine housekeeping activities.

  • Follow written procedures and manufacturing documentation for multiple product lines.

  • Comply with all clean room, gowning, and uniform requirements.

  • Follow instructions and guidance from team leads and supervisors.

  • Complete additional duties and special projects as assigned.

Qualifications

  • Previous experience performing manual assembly in a manufacturing or production environment.

  • Ability to assemble small, delicate components using magnification equipment or a microscope.

  • Soldering experience preferred, but not required.

  • Experience in medical device or other regulated manufacturing environments is a plus.

  • Familiarity with standard manufacturing and assembly processes.

  • Proficiency using hand tools.

  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to producing high-quality work.

  • Excellent manual dexterity and hand-eye coordination.
